14:22 — Offline sync regression confirmed (Terrapath field-survey app)

At 14:22 the on-call engineer reproduced the data-loss path: surveys saved while offline were marked synced once connectivity returned, even when the upload was rejected. The queue flush skipped the server acknowledgement check introduced in the previous sprint. Release manager note: the fix must ship before the coastal survey season. The offending build is identified by the token recorded below.

session token of kawif-fawig = htk31_f3f599be2b1a34affb1efa8d0feccf8

Step 4 of the Brackenmere migration: enabling offline mode for the Fernpath field-survey app. Reviewer, please confirm the local queue writes survey responses to the embedded store before any network call, and that replay on reconnect is idempotent — duplicate submission was the main defect in the Quillbury pilot. Also verify the sync worker backs off exponentially rather than hammering the gateway when cell coverage flaps. Once those checks pass, apply the following configuration to the staging environment.

settings of tagef-bawif:
DRUIX_HOST=druix.zemvarlabs.internal
DRUIX_PORT=8000

The HarrowLink gateway aggregates telemetry from combines and seeders across the Vellbrook test fields. Under normal conditions, access goes through the standard rotation handled by the Fieldworks platform team. If the gateway stops forwarding CAN-bus data and the platform team is unreachable, break-glass access is permitted. Open an incident first, then retrieve the emergency credentials from the sealed operations binder. Any break-glass use must be reported at the next standup. The passphrase to unlock the emergency bundle appears below.

unlock words, yawig-kagef: gordor-holvan-ulaael-pramir-ulaiel-tamdor